A soviet animated short made in 1981 about a little mammoth who froze into an ice, thawed out in modern times, and now is looking for his mother.

Tropes used in Mother for Little Mammoth include:
- Earn Your Happy Ending
- Harmless Freezing
- Hey, It's That Voice!: Lillle Mammoth is a Hare, Walrus is Captain Vrungel and Panikovsky.
- Mammoth Popsicle
- Missing Mom
- Ridiculously Cute Critter: a cute little mammoth. Awwww.
- Somewhere a Paleontologist Is Crying: The mammoth's big ears are essential for the plot... except such ears are the elephant's heat sinks, and weren't possessed by the mammoths.
